
Max Han, director of the western Sydney-based printing company, will receive a Ford XR6 after winning the Roland DG 'buy an XR, win an XR' competition, which was launched last year in conjunction with the Soljet Pro4 XR-640.
Roland DG distributor Australian Visual Solutions sold the Soljet to Colourland last October.
AVS managing director Cameron Sutherland said: "Max made the right decision buying a new Roland XR-640 as not only has he increased his production capacity with the printer's high-speed output, he now has a Ford XR6 to add to his fleet."
Roland DG managing director Marc Margetts said: "We were excited to launch this competition last year for the release of the new Pro4 series products.
"Roland's XR-640 and Ford's XR6 not only have model numbers in common, but also amazing performance, which is why we selected this lucrative prize."
